On This Date: Aug. 20, 1983

August 20, 1983 — Bob Thomas betters a field of 119 runners in 90-degree heat to capture first place at the Panther Valley 10-Mile Run. Thomas, of Jim Thorpe, turns in a time of 54:49 to finish 40 seconds ahead of runner-up Dave Horvath of Palmerton. The top female finisher, who placed 22nd overall, was Tamaqua’s Lori Lawson, who was clocked in an hour, five minutes, and 46 seconds. Other runners from the area to place in the top 10 include Palmerton’s Billy Cyr (ninth) and Art Iris (10th).
